Q: My plugin's export to Driftbook failed — how do retries work?

A: Failed exports are retried automatically with exponential backoff: 1m, 5m, 30m, then hourly for 24h. After that the job moves to the dead-letter queue and your plugin must call the resubmit hook. If the export failed because the archive keystore was sealed (common after node restarts), retries will keep failing until it's unsealed. Unsealing requires the shared recovery passphrase distributed to registered plugin authors, shown below.

vault phrase of taweg-kafof = oliax-zorael

Leadership Review Briefing — Customer Concentration

Hey sales leads — heads up before the leadership review. Fennick Traders now makes up nearly half of Bluehollow Supply's quarterly revenue, which is great for bonuses but risky for everyone's sleep. If their procurement team sneezes, our forecast catches a cold. Leadership wants three new mid-size accounts in the pipeline by next review, so start working your contacts. The confidential note on where we're headed is just below.

board note of fahif-yahog: Gross margin on Wenath came in at 10 percent against a plan of 5 percent. Only 3 of the 100 pilot accounts renewed Wenath, so a churn review is set for July 15.

Onboarding: Inkfeed markdown pipeline. All user-submitted markdown passes through the Scrubwell sanitizer before the Pressgate renderer touches it. Raw HTML is stripped, not escaped — review any change to that behavior. Rendered output is cached per-document; cache keys include the sanitizer version, so bumping Scrubwell invalidates everything. The renderer runs in an isolated pod with no outbound network. It authenticates to the asset store with a token set in the environment file; that entry goes directly below this sentence.

sealed setting: ARCHIVE_KEY3=8d0

### Action Item: Spoolhaven Retry Storm

From last Tuesday's outage: the Spoolhaven print service retried failed jobs without backoff, saturating the render pool. Fix merged; retries now use capped exponential backoff with jitter. Owner will monitor for a week before closing. The agreed retry constants are recorded below.

constants for yadup-kajof:
RATE_LIMITS = {
    "zorwyn": 1,
    "druwyn": 1,
}